I spent some time during the season and placed a lot of cards I wasn't using in match play on the rental market. The results were fantastic! I ended up doubling my rental income this season over last season. I expect to place a few more rentals on the market this season. I am also learning to spend a few minutes every day tweeking my existing rentals and would not be surprised to see this seasons income double again from this level.

I currently have over 30,000 SPS staked and my Staking rewards have now become a major part of my SPS airdrop. I know when they finally implement the new staking system my Staking Rewards will probably go down so I'm trying to gather all I can until then.

avatar
(Edited)

They should all be about the same. All are just different front ends to the Hive blockchain. Splintertalk just restricts it's displayed posts to #splinterlands and #spt tagged posts and displayes rewards in SPT instead of $$.
